.slu-button-wrapper {
    display: flex;
}

.slu-button-wrapper > * {
    margin-right: 5px;
    margin-left: 5px;
}

.slu-button, a.cc-btn.cc-dismiss {
    flex: 1;
    align-items: center;
    background-color: var(--slu-havsvik);
    border: 1px solid transparent;
    border-radius: 22px;
    color: white;
    font-family: var(--slu-font-oswald);
    font-size: 1.5rem;
    font-weight: 300                                                !important;
    justify-content: center;
    line-height: 1.5;
    margin-bottom: 10px;
    padding: 16px 17px;
    text-align: center;
    overflow-wrap: anywhere;
}

.slu-button:hover, .slu-button:focus, a.cc-btn.cc-dismiss:hover, a.cc-btn.cc-dismiss:focus {
    background-color: var(--slu-havsdjup);
    border-bottom-color: transparent;
    -webkit-box-shadow: none;
    -moz-box-shadow: none;
    box-shadow: none;
    color: white;
}

.slu-button:visited, .slu-button:visited:hover, .slu-button:visited:focus, a.cc-btn.cc-dismiss:visited, a.cc-btn.cc-dismiss:visited:hover, a.cc-btn.cc-dismiss:visited:focus {
    color: white;
}

.slu-button:focus-visible, a.cc-btn.cc-dismiss:focus-visible {
    outline: var(--focus-outline);
    outline-offset: var(--focus-outline-offset);
}

.slu-button.light {
    background-color: rgba(255, 255, 255, 0.9);
    border-color: var(--slu-havsvik);
    color: var(--slu-havsdjup);
}

.slu-button.light:hover, .slu-button.light:focus, .slu-button.light:visited:hover, .slu-button.light:visited:focus {
    background-color: var(--slu-havsvik);
    color: white;
}

.slu-button.light:visited {
    color: var(--slu-havsdjup);
}

.slu-button.slim, a.cc-btn.cc-dismiss {
    width: unset;
    font-size: 1.25rem;
    padding: 5px 16px 6px;
}

a.cc-btn.cc-dismiss {
    margin-bottom: 0;
}

/* hover background color change for buttons inside of search area for contrast */
.search .slu-button.light:hover, .search .slu-button.light:focus, .search .slu-button.light:visited:hover, .search .slu-button.light:visited:focus {
    background-color: var(--slu-havsdjup);
    border-color: var(--slu-havsdjup);
}
